The Federal Republic of Germany and the European Community (RLE: German Politics)

Originally published in 1987, this book examines German governmental policy from 1969-1986 and explains this in terms of the political, economic and administrative dynamics of the (then) Federal Republic. The study includes analysis of the attitudes and the role of West German interest groups, political parties, public opinion, the legislature and the federal states regarding European policy. The book is based on extensive interviews as well as the authors’ familiarity with the institutions and key players involved. It will appeal to students of German politics, the EU and international relations.

Federal Republic of Germany

This chapter reviews recent economic developments and economic prospects in which the emergence of the principal imbalances is traced, and their persistent character highlighted in the Federal Republic of Germany. On macroeconomic policies, while one might quibble about the rate of expansion of the money supply or the timing of tax reduction and reform, the paper does not find major errors in the formulation or implementation of policies that would account for the principal economic imbalances. The need to reduce rules and regulations, which act to limit the flexibility and dynamism of the German economy, has been reinforced by the objective of fully liberalizing trade in services within the European Community by 1992. The banking industry is exempt from the provisions of the antitrust law, which prohibits restraints on competition, price collusion, and other collusive agreements. Among economists, there is a broad agreement that structural reforms in Germany would greatly improve economic performance and contribute to external adjustment.

Government in the Federal Republic of Germany

Government in the Federal Republic of Germany: The Executive at Work focuses on the government in the Federal Republic of Germany as an executive activity, as well as the institutional framework for the overall control and direction of public action. The effects of the decentralized structure of government on the behavior and relationships of political parties are also explored. This book is comprised of eight chapters and begins with a discussion on past institutional structures and procedures that have shaped particular ideas about law, politics, and government in West Germany, including the retention of a federal structure of government, constitutionalism, and the Rechtsstaat. The following chapters deal with the political framework of the Federal Republic of Germany; federal executive leadership; the federal administrative system; and federalism and decentralization in West German government. The bureaucracy, the problem of how to control the exercise of governmental powers, and the challenge of expanding government in West Germany are also considered. This monograph will be of interest to political scientists, politicians, government officials, and students of government and politics.
